SECTION 3: CHEMICAL/PHYSICAL DATA
This item is a light bulb. The outer bulb is quartz glass, and the inner arc tube is ceramic. Other
chemical or physical characteristics are not applicable.

SECTION 4: FIRE AND EXPLOSION DATA
The outer envelope encloses a ceramic arc tube, which is refractory. There is a partial vacuum
within the outer envelope. If the lamp is dropped or struck, a possible implosion could result
which would cause flying glass.
Warning: The arc tubes of metal halide lamps are designed to operate under high pressure and at
temperatures up to 900• C. If the arc tube ruptures for any reason, the outer bulb might break
and pieces of extremely hot glass might be discharged into the surrounding environment, with the
associated risk of property damage or personal injury.

SECTION 5: REACTIVITY DATA
Stability: Lamp is stable.
Incompatibility: Glass Envelope will react with hydrofluoric acid.
Caution: If a lamp bulb support is used, be sure to
insulate the support electrically so as to avoid possible
decomposition to the bulb glass. Polymerization will
not occur.
